This picture is from an episode of One Tree Hill where Peyton says, “At the end of the day, people always leave.”
As a therapist—and personally—I hear this belief all the time.
When multiple relationships or friendships end, it’s natural to start wondering 💭
Is it me?
Is something wrong or broken in me?
Why don’t people stay?
Why do people leave or abandon me?
Over time, this fear can turn inward. Sometimes we begin to self-sabotage relationships—not because we don’t care, but because we’re afraid they’ll leave first. So we test, pull away, overgive, or subconsciously prove to ourselves that “it won’t work anyway.”
But fear of abandonment is not a flaw—it’s a learned survival response.
And it can be healed. 💛
You are not too much. You are not unlovable. And not everyone who leaves is a reflection of your worth.
